Work Order Contract (Sample)
|
- 1. In consideration of the mutual promises
set forth below in the body of this contract,
Customer and Gunsmith agree as follows:
- 2. Gunsmith shall undertake
gunsmithing work as set forth in the Work Order.
- 3. The
Customer is informed, realizes and understands that any alterations
which the Customer has requested to
be done to the Customer's gun, pursuant to
the Work Order, may release the Manufacturer from any liability for any
accident should any occur.
- 4. The
Customer recognizes, realizes, and by reading and signing the Work Order,
understands that by the Customer's request that these
changes occur, that he is also releasing the
Gunsmith, both individually and in any business form, from any liability should any
accident occur because of the requested changes or alterations.
- 5. The
Customer will indemnify and defend the Gunsmith from all liability
for any loss, damage or injury to persons or
property arising from or related to the
performance of the agreement including, without limitation, all
consequential damages whether or
not resulting from the negligence of the Customer or Customer's
agent.
- 6. If
any legal action, including a legal action in contract law, tort law
or criminal law
, including an action for declaratory relief is brought to enforce or
interpret the provisions of this contract, or a
suit of liability, then the prevailing
party shall be entitled to recover reasonable attorney's fees from the other party.
These fees which may be set by the court in the same action or in a
separate action, brought for that purpose,
are in addition to any other relief to which the
prevailing party may be entitled.
- 7. This
agreement supersedes and and all other agreements either oral or
in writing, between the Customer and the Gunsmith
wit
h respect to the subject of this contract.
This contract contains all of the covenants and agreements between the
parties with respect to the gunsmithing work
pursuant to the Work Order and each party
to this contract acknowledges that no
representations, inducements, promises or
agreements have been made by or on behalf of any party, except those covenants and agreement
ts embodied in this contract. No Agreement, statement or promise not
contained in this contract shall be binding
or valid.
- 8. The validity of this
agreement and any of its terms or provisions, as well as the rights and duties of the
parties under this agreement, shall be construed
pursuant to and in accordance with the laws of the State of
California.
- 9.
If any term of this agreement is held by a court of competent
jurisdiction to be void or unenforceable, the
remainder of the contract terms shall remain
in full force and effect and shall not b
e affected.
- 10. Any jobs left in
the shop for more than 30 days after written
notification will be sold to cover expenses.
- 11. All guns not picked up within 30 days after verbal notification will be subject to a storage fee of $30.00 each per month retroactive unless prior arrangement by Danforth Gunsmithing. At that time a written notification will be sent to you in accordance with paragraph 10 of the work order contract.
- 12. Customer Cancellations: If a gun is left with Danforth Gunsmithing for work and then cancelled by the owner at any time after the work is written up and a deposit accepted there will be a cancellation charge in the amount of $35.00 plus an additional charge of 5% of the deposit amount if given by credit card or atm card. There may be additional charges for time spent in consultations above 1/2 hour at a rate of $65.00 per hour. Any amounts of expenses accrued before the cancellation request will be due or deducted from the deposit amount.
- 13. NSF & Returned Check Policy: Any NSF checks will be charged a $35.00 reprocessing fee. If the check is returned to Danforth Gunsmithing again, an additional charge of $25.00 will be added to the invoice balance.
- 14. Parts Ordering Policy: We will order parts only for our customers as long as they are not safety components. We charge a minimum of $25 plus shipping/handling and sales tax. All returned parts are accepted only in the original condition as sold and is at the discretion of Danforth Gunsmithing.
- 15. Deposit Policy: Danforth Gunsmithing requires a deposit on each work order in the amount of $35.00 minimum up to 50% of the work order or the total of parts, which ever is the greater. We accept Visa, Mastercard, Discover, we prefer Debit cards, personal checks and of course CASH is prefered.

Addendum
Agreement and Release From Liability
|
I,
also known as t
he Customer, acknowledge that I have voluntarily requested of
Danforth Gunsmithing, activities with include, but which is not limited
to, modifications and alterations to a gun which may affect various
safety systems.
|
Assumption of Risk
|
I
am aware that alterations and modifications of guns may be hazardous.
I am voluntarily requesting that these activities take place with the knowledge of the dangers
involved which include death, dismemberment and paralysis, and I
hereby agree to accept any and all risks or injury or death and verify this statement by placing my signature on this contract.
|
As
consideration for this gunsmithing being performed pursuant to my
direction, I hereby agree that I, my assignees, heirs, distributees,
guardians an
d legal representatives, will not make a claim against, sue or
attach the property of Danforth Gunsmithing, or any of its
affiliated organizations, for injuries or damages resulting from
negligence or other acts how so ever caused by Danforth Gunsmithing, or any employee, agent or contractor of Danforth
Gunsmithing, or any of it affiliated organizations as a result from
my request for modification or alteration to a gun.
|
I
hereby release Danforth Gunsmithing and any of its affiliated
organizations from all actions, claims or demands that I, my assignees,
heirs, distributees, guardians or legal representatives now have or
may hereafter have for
injuries or damages resulting from my request of modification or
alteration to a gun set forth in this Work Order.
